Determine the empirical formula of a compound containing 48.38 grams of carbon, 8.12 grams of hydrogen, and 53.5 grams of oxygen.

In an experiment, the molar mass of the compound was determined to be 180.15 g/mol. What is the molecular formula of the compound?

For both questions, show your work or explain how you determined the formulas by giving specific values used in calculations.
